The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Hughes, born in 1847 in , consisted of 7 members. William was the head of the household, married to Mary Hughes, born in 1849 in Port Glasgow, Renfrewshire, Scotland. They had 4 children; John (born 1870 in Linwood, Renfrewshire, Scotland), James (born 1873 in Johnstone, Renfrewshire, Scotland), Elizabeth (born 1875 in Johnstone, Renfrewshire, Scotland) and Mary (born 1878 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household was William's Visitor, Bella Hall, born in 1863 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
